Tamsin Smith is a published poet, novelist, essayist, and painter.
Her debut verse collection Word Cave was published by Risk Press in January 2018. FMSBW released Between First & Second Sleep in September 2018, and Displacement Geology in December 2020. Her first work of fiction, XISLE, a novel is now also available from FMSBW.

Her paintings have shown in group exhibitions at Modern Eden Gallery, The Luggage Store Gallery, Avenue 12 Gallery, Analog Gallery, Guerrero Gallery, Incline Gallery, King Gallery, and Adobe Books Backroom Gallery, which also exhibited her solo show “Painting as a Second Language” and an exhibition of her collaborations with Emilio Villalba, titled “The Painter’s Alphabet”.
